Governance Professional - Complaints and Governance Support

Inspiration Trust · Norwich · Norfolk

Job description

About You:

We are looking for a professional, impartial and highly organised individual with strong administrative, written communication and record-management skills. You will be confident interpreting and applying policies, statutory guidance and procedures, handling sensitive information and managing competing deadlines. You will have excellent attention to detail, be calm under pressure and able to communicate diplomatically with a wide range of stakeholders.

Professional Development

As part of the role, the successful candidate will have an opportunity to study towards a recognised governance qualification. Dedicated study time will be agreed within your contracted working hours, providing an excellent opportunity to develop your professional knowledge and expertise while gaining valuable practical experience in the role. This is an ideal opportunity for someone looking to build a career in governance and gain a recognised professional qualification alongside their day-to-day work.

Essential:

  • GCSE English and Mathematics at grade 5/C or above, or equivalent.
  • A relevant Level 3 qualification or equivalent substantial professional experience.
  • Strong administrative, organisational, written communication and record-management skills.
  • Experience handling sensitive information and competing statutory or policy deadlines.
  • Ability to clerk formal meetings and produce clear, accurate and impartial minutes, alongside strong digital skills including Microsoft 365.

Desirable:

  • Commitment to study towards and complete a recognised governance qualification, with study time agreed within contracted working hours.
  • A qualification in governance, legal, public administration, data protection or the education sector.
  • Experience working in an academy trust, school, public body or other regulated environment.
  • Experience using Governor Hub or a comparable governance management system.
  • Experience of formal panels, hearings, appeals or casework relevant to the role.
  • Willingness to attend evening meetings and travel across Trust locations.
